<pre style='margin:0'>
Perry E. Metzger (pmetzger)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/7c587aeafc118f5438a58372119b219aa9462b8c">https://github.com/macports/macports-ports/commit/7c587aeafc118f5438a58372119b219aa9462b8c</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'>     new 7c587aeafc1 vorbis-tools: update to 1.4.2
</span>7c587aeafc1 is described below

<span style='display:block; white-space:pre;color:#808000;'>commit 7c587aeafc118f5438a58372119b219aa9462b8c
</span>Author: contextnerror <contextnerror@outlook.com>
AuthorDate: Thu Sep 21 21:14:08 2023 -0700

<span style='display:block; white-space:pre;color:#404040;'>    vorbis-tools: update to 1.4.2
</span><span style='display:block; white-space:pre;color:#404040;'>    
</span><span style='display:block; white-space:pre;color:#404040;'>    - patch WimplicitFunctionDeclaration on Big Sur
</span><span style='display:block; white-space:pre;color:#404040;'>    - fix linking problem on Monterey+
</span>---
 audio/vorbis-tools/Portfile                         | 17 ++++++++++++-----
 audio/vorbis-tools/files/c99-compatibility-fix.diff | 11 +++++++++++
 audio/vorbis-tools/files/recursive-a-fix.diff       | 12 ++++++++++++
 3 files changed, 35 insertions(+), 5 deletions(-)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/audio/vorbis-tools/Portfile b/audio/vorbis-tools/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 869e988f522..b7566fe6dc0 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/audio/vorbis-tools/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/audio/vorbis-tools/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-3,8 +3,8 @@
</span> PortSystem          1.0
 
 name                vorbis-tools
<span style='display:block; white-space:pre;background:#ffe0e0;'>-version             1.4.0
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-revision            2
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+version             1.4.2
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ision            0
</span> categories          audio
 maintainers         nomaintainer
 
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-21,9 +21,12 @@ license             GPL-2+ BSD LGPL-2+
</span> homepage            http://www.vorbis.com/
 master_sites        https://ftp.osuosl.org/pub/xiph/releases/vorbis/
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-checksums           md5     567e0fb8d321b2cd7124f8208b8b90e6 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                    sha1    fc6a820bdb5ad6fcac074721fab5c3f96eaf6562 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                    rmd160  ff21e5c9456ac0a82b8eda4e53931db8522a2ccd
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+patchfiles          c99-compatibility-fix.diff \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                    recursive-a-fix.diff
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+checksums           rmd160  f0f4f859b3a280dfe7ea9a13dc4c39ed3ed37c80 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                    sha256  db7774ec2bf2c939b139452183669be84fda5774d6400fc57fde37f77624f0b0 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                    size    1389947
</span> 
 depends_lib \
                     port:libogg \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-32,6 +35,7 @@ depends_lib \
</span>                     port:libao \
                     port:gettext
 
<span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> configure.args \
     --mandir=${prefix}/share/man \
     --with-ao \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-40,6 +44,9 @@ configure.args \
</span>     --without-speex \
     --enable-vcut
 
<span style='display:block; white-space:pre;background:#e0ffe0;'>+use_autoreconf      yes
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+autoreconf.args        --force --install --verbose
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> variant flac description "Enable FLAC support" {
   depends_lib-append    port:flac
   configure.args-delete --without-flac
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/audio/vorbis-tools/files/c99-compatibility-fix.diff b/audio/vorbis-tools/files/c99-compatibility-fix.diff
</span>new file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 00000000000..ed2ce1b4429
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--- /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/audio/vorbis-tools/files/c99-compatibility-fix.diff
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-0,0 +1,11 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# https://gitlab.xiph.org/xiph/vorbis-tools/-/commit/ec3a1a1de87168f575b93bc9cedcfaeb82c048a4
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- ogginfo/codec_skeleton.c.orig  2021-01-08 15:13:55.000000000 -0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 ogginfo/codec_skeleton.c       2023-09-22 08:35:40.000000000 -0700
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-25,6 +25,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#include <ogg/ogg.h>
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#include "i18n.h"
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++#include "utf8.h"
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 #include "private.h"
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;color:#808080;'>diff --git a/audio/vorbis-tools/files/recursive-a-fix.diff b/audio/vorbis-tools/files/recursive-a-fix.diff
</span>new file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 00000000000..36f5f6b10d3
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--- /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/audio/vorbis-tools/files/recursive-a-fix.diff
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-0,0 +1,12 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# https://github.com/Homebrew/homebrew-core/pull/130403/commits/d2669dc292397c7b2d51c3640c58584bcc1ba183
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+--- share/Makefile.am.orig 2021-01-03 08:35:46.000000000 -0800
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++++ share/Makefile.am      2023-09-24 13:51:18.000000000 -0700
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+@@ -11,7 +11,7 @@
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 libbase64_a_SOURCES = base64.c
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 libpicture_a_SOURCES = picture.c
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+-libpicture_a_LIBADD = libbase64.a
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>++libpicture_a_LIBADD = base64.o
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 EXTRA_DIST = charmaps.h makemap.c charset_test.c charsetmap.h
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 
</span></pre><pre style='margin:0'>

</pre>